Liz and Sarah talk about why it’s important never to delete anything substantial. They never know when they’re going to want to put something back into a document. It happens! In Take A Hike, Sarah shares why being at her lake house in Minnesota made her realize it’s important to “look down.” Next, Liz and Sarah revisit the topic of crying at work in Take Two. Listeners have so many observations and insights! This week’s Hollywood Hack is great for summer — try mini soda cans. Finally, Sarah recommends the Mr. Darcy and Miss Tilney mystery book series.   Sign up for Liz and Sarah’s free weekly newsletter at  https://happierinhollywoodpod.substack.com. For over two decades, television writers Liz Craft and Sarah Fain have navigated the unique pressures of Hollywood as a team, and their Happier in Hollywood podcast pulls back the curtain on that journey. This isn't just industry gossip; it's a candid conversation between two friends who have built a career and a life inside a famously tough town. Each episode feels like grabbing a table at the commissary with them, where they translate their personal and professional hurdles into relatable lessons. You’ll hear how a blend of stubborn optimism and pragmatic Midwestern grit helped them thrive in a male-dominated field, offering tangible advice that goes far beyond writing a script. Their discussions tackle everything from navigating office politics and difficult conversations to the small, daily practices that maintain sanity. This Happier in Hollywood podcast, from The Onward Project, transforms specific Hollywood struggles into universal themes about resilience, partnership, and finding your footing in any high-stakes career. It’s about the unglamorous work behind the glamour-the ass-kicking, the occasional ass-kissing, and yes, even the office yoga-that actually makes a sustainable life possible. Tune in for a surprisingly grounded perspective from two veterans who have learned to carve out happiness on their own terms.
